Habit cues, also referred to as triggers, are the environmental or internal stimuli that initiate specific behaviors. These cues can be categorized as external, such as visual stimuli (e.g., seeing a tempting dessert) or auditory stimuli (e.g., hearing a notification), or internal, such as emotional states (e.g., feeling stressed) or physiological cues (e.g., feeling hunger). These cues function as subconscious prompts, automatically activating pre-programmed behavioral responses, often operating outside conscious awareness. This process is deeply rooted in the brain’s efficient allocation of cognitive resources, as detailed in the cognitive load theory.

The efficiency of the brain is central to habit formation. To conserve cognitive energy, the brain establishes neural pathways that automate frequently performed actions. The repetition reinforced by habit cues strengthens these pathways, making the associated actions increasingly automatic. This neurological efficiency, explained by principles of synaptic plasticity and long-term potentiation, explains both the challenges in breaking ingrained habits and the transformative potential of establishing beneficial ones. The ease or difficulty of changing a behavior is directly related to the strength of its associated neural pathways, illustrating the importance of consistent effort in modifying habits.

The Habit Loop and Cue-Driven Behavior

The habit loop model posits that habits are composed of three key elements: a cue, a routine, and a reward. Habit cues, or triggers, are stimuli—internal or external—that initiate the behavioral sequence. These cues can range from environmental factors (e.g., time of day, location, presence of certain people or objects) to internal states (e.g., emotions, physiological sensations). The theory of planned behavior further suggests that intentions, influenced by attitudes, subjective norms, and perceived behavioral control, mediate the relationship between cues and the enactment of the behavior itself. Understanding this interplay between intention, cue, and behavior is crucial for effective habit modification.

Neurobiological Underpinnings of Habit Formation

Habit formation is rooted in neuroplasticity, the brain’s capacity to reorganize itself by forming new neural pathways. Repeated pairing of a cue with a specific behavior strengthens the associated neural connections, automating the response. This process is governed by dopaminergic reward pathways, reinforcing behaviors associated with positive outcomes. By understanding this neural mechanism, we can strategically manipulate environmental cues and reward systems to foster desired behaviors and weaken undesirable ones, effectively rewiring the brain for positive change. This aligns with the principles of operant conditioning, where rewards strengthen behaviors and punishments weaken them.

1. Circadian Rhythm Synchronization: Establishing a Consistent Sleep Schedule

The human circadian rhythm, the body’s internal biological clock, governs sleep-wake cycles. Maintaining a consistent sleep-wake schedule, including weekends, is crucial for regulating this rhythm and promoting natural sleep patterns. This consistency minimizes disruptions, optimizing sleep architecture and consolidating sleep stages. Adherence to a regular sleep-wake cycle, even when faced with variations in social or work schedules, is fundamental to improving sleep quality. Deviation from this schedule can lead to a phenomenon known as “social jet lag,” characterized by similar symptoms to jet lag, including daytime fatigue and impaired cognitive performance.

2. Minimizing Environmental Stimuli: Reducing Exposure to Blue Light and Other Distractions

Exposure to blue light, emitted from electronic devices, suppresses melatonin production, a key hormone regulating sleep-wake cycles. The application of chronobiological principles dictates minimizing screen time at least one to two hours before bedtime. This reduction in blue light exposure promotes natural melatonin release, facilitating sleep onset. Furthermore, a quiet and dark bedroom environment, free from external light and noise distractions, optimizes the sleep environment. This aligns with the principles of stimulus control therapy, a behavioral intervention that aims to reduce sleep-related environmental cues that might interfere with falling asleep.

1. Diversified Micronutrient Intake: A diet rich in diverse fruits and vegetables forms the cornerstone of immune optimization. This aligns with the concept of nutritional adequacy, emphasizing the consumption of a wide array of foods to ensure sufficient intake of essential vitamins and minerals. The abundance of vitamins (e.g., vitamin C, essential for white blood cell production) and antioxidants in these foods neutralizes free radicals, protecting cells from oxidative stress and bolstering immune defenses. For instance, the high vitamin C content in citrus fruits contributes significantly to enhanced immune cell activity. This principle is further supported by the Bioavailability concept, emphasizing the body’s ability to absorb and utilize these nutrients effectively.

2. Cultivating a Thriving Gut Microbiome: The gut microbiome significantly influences immune function, a core tenet of the gut-brain-immune axis model. The ingestion of probiotic-rich foods (e.g., yogurt, kefir, kimchi) introduces beneficial bacteria, promoting a balanced gut microbiota. This contributes to improved digestion, nutrient absorption, and the production of short-chain fatty acids which modulate the immune response. The impact of gut microbiota composition on immune function is well-established; an imbalance (dysbiosis) can lead to impaired immunity. This concept aligns with the microbiota-gut-brain axis theory.

3. Strategic Mineral Supplementation: Zinc, an essential trace mineral, plays a crucial role in immune cell proliferation and function. Zinc deficiency can impair both innate and adaptive immunity. Foods like whole grains, legumes, nuts, and seafood are excellent sources. However, supplementation might be considered in cases of confirmed deficiency, guided by recommendations from healthcare professionals, and taking into account possible interactions with other medications or supplements. Defining and Understanding Male Infertility: A Biopsychosocial Perspective

Male infertility is defined as the inability to achieve pregnancy with a fertile partner following a year of regular, unprotected intercourse. This definition incorporates the World Health Organization’s criteria and acknowledges the contribution of both biological and psychosocial factors. Understanding male infertility requires a biopsychosocial approach, integrating biological mechanisms, psychological factors, and the social context surrounding reproductive health. The etiology is multifaceted, encompassing factors ranging from hormonal imbalances and genetic predispositions to lifestyle choices and environmental exposures. Accurate diagnosis relies on a comprehensive assessment integrating clinical history, physical examination, and advanced diagnostic techniques.

Etiology of Male Infertility: Exploring Contributing Factors

The causes of male infertility are diverse and often intertwined. We can categorize contributing factors using the biopsychosocial model:

  • Biological Factors: This category encompasses a wide range of conditions. Genetic factors, such as Klinefelter syndrome (XXY karyotype), cystic fibrosis, and Y chromosome microdeletions, can directly impair spermatogenesis (sperm production). Endocrine disorders, including hypogonadism (deficient testosterone production) and hyperprolactinemia (elevated prolactin levels), disrupt the hormonal cascade essential for male reproduction. Varicoceles, dilated veins in the scrotum, can cause increased scrotal temperature, hindering sperm production. Infections, such as mumps orchitis (inflammation of the testes), can damage testicular tissue. Structural abnormalities of the reproductive tract, such as obstructions or ejaculatory duct defects, also contribute to infertility.
  • Lifestyle Factors: These factors significantly impact reproductive health. The impact of environmental toxins, including heavy metals and pesticides, on spermatogenesis has been extensively studied. Studies employing epidemiological models have demonstrated a strong correlation between smoking and reduced sperm parameters (concentration, motility, morphology). Excessive alcohol consumption negatively affects testosterone synthesis and sperm quality. Obesity is associated with hormonal imbalances (e.g., reduced testosterone, increased estrogen) leading to impaired spermatogenesis. Chronic stress, characterized by elevated cortisol levels, can further compromise reproductive function. Applying the Health Belief Model, we understand that individual perceptions of risk and benefits related to these lifestyle choices directly influence behavior change.
  • Iatrogenic Factors: Certain medications and medical treatments can cause temporary or permanent infertility. Chemotherapy and radiation therapy, frequently employed in cancer treatment, often damage spermatogenic cells. Some medications, such as anabolic steroids and certain antidepressants, can also negatively impact sperm production and function.

A thorough diagnostic workup, incorporating semen analysis (WHO guidelines), hormonal assessments, and genetic testing, is essential to identify the underlying cause(s) of infertility.

Therapeutic Interventions: From Lifestyle Modifications to Assisted Reproductive Technologies

Treatment approaches for male infertility are tailored to the underlying etiology and vary widely in complexity. Initial strategies often involve lifestyle modifications, reflecting a preventative health approach:

  • Lifestyle Optimization: This includes smoking cessation, moderation of alcohol consumption, weight management through dietary changes and exercise (guided by principles of behavior modification), and stress reduction techniques such as mindfulness-based stress reduction or cognitive behavioral therapy. The efficacy of these interventions can be monitored through repeat semen analysis, providing objective markers of progress.

If lifestyle modifications prove insufficient, medical interventions become necessary:

  • Pharmacological Interventions: Hormone replacement therapy (HRT) might be indicated for hormonal imbalances (e.g., testosterone deficiency). Antioxidants, such as Vitamin E and Vitamin C, may improve sperm parameters in some cases. However, the efficacy of such supplements remains a subject of ongoing research.
  • Assisted Reproductive Technologies (ART): When other treatments fail, ART offers a pathway to parenthood. Intrauterine insemination (IUI) involves introducing washed sperm directly into the uterus. In-vitro fertilization (IVF) and intracytoplasmic sperm injection (ICSI) are more advanced techniques, involving fertilization outside the body and subsequent embryo transfer. The success rate of ART varies depending on the underlying cause of infertility and the patient’s age.
  • Surgical Interventions: Varicocele repair, microsurgical vasectomy reversal, and other surgical procedures might be considered to correct anatomical abnormalities or structural defects.

Addressing the Psychosocial Impact of Male Infertility: The Importance of Support

Male infertility significantly impacts not only reproductive health but also psychological well-being. The diagnosis can lead to feelings of shame, guilt, inadequacy, and depression. Addressing these psychosocial challenges is an integral part of comprehensive care:

  • Individual and Couples Therapy: These therapeutic approaches provide a supportive environment to process emotions, improve communication, and build coping mechanisms. Cognitive Behavioral Therapy (CBT) can assist in modifying negative thought patterns and behaviors related to infertility.
  • Support Groups and Peer Support Networks: Sharing experiences with others facing similar challenges can significantly reduce feelings of isolation and foster a sense of community.

The application of the social support theory highlights the critical role of social networks in providing emotional and practical support, influencing the overall well-being of individuals experiencing infertility.
